[POWERPC] Make endianess of cfg_addr for indirect pci ops runtime

Make it so we do a runtime check to know if we need to write cfg_addr
as big or little endian.  This is needed if we want to allow 86xx support
to co-exist in the same kernel as other 6xx PPCs.
